what is the definition of perception?
|
a process by which individuals organize and interpret their sensory impressions in order to give meaning to their environment.
|
|
what is the person perception definition of attribution theory?
|
an attempt to determine whether an individual's behavior is internally or externally cause.
|
|
what is the person perception definition of fundamental attribution error?
|
The tendency to underestimate the influence of external factors and over estimate the influence of internal factors when making judgments about the behavior of others.
|
|
what is the person perception definition of self-serving bias?
|
the tendency for individuals to attribute their own successes to internal factors and put the blame for failures on external factors.
|
|
what is the definition of frequent used shortcut in judging other selective perception?
|
the tendency to selectivity interpret what one sees on the basis of ones interest background experience and attitudes.
|
|
what is the definition of frequent used shortcut in judging other halo effect ?
|
the tendency to draw to draw a general impression about an individual on the basis of a single characteristic.
|
|
what is the definition of frequent used shortcut in judging other contrast effect?
|
Evaluation of person's characteristics that is affected by comparisons with other people recently encountered who rank higher or lower on the same characteristics.
|
|
stereotyping
|
judging someone on the basis of ones perception of the group to which that person belongs.
|
|
profiling
|
A form of sterotypingin which a group of individuals is singled out typically on the basis of race or ethnicity for intensive inquiry scrutiny or investigation.
|
|
what is the definition of self-fulfilling prophecy?
|
a situation in which a person inaccurately perceives a second person, and the resulting expectations cause the second person to behave in ways consistent with the original perception.
